Bihar Government inks deal with ONGC-Tata Petrodyne for oil exploration

Bihar Government inked an agreement with the Oil and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C) and its JV partner Tata Petrodyne to explore petroleum and natural gas in a 2227-sq km area in West Champaran (Bettiah) district.
The agreement was signed by Phool Singh, Principal Secretary, Mines and Geology department, and ONGC's General Manager (Frontier Basin), N K Verma, in the presenceof Tata Petrodyne Chief Financial Officer, A Guha, in Patna on October 29, 2009.
Bihar Cabinet had approved a Petroleum Exploration License (PEL) application of ONGC and Tata Petrodyne earlier this month.
